Luanda - Ruling MPLA party appealed to the citizens Thursday for the mass participation in the electoral registration process, to ensure their participation in 2022 polls.
The appeal is expressed in the final communiqué of the 17th ordinary meeting of party’s Secretariat of the Political Bureau (BP), chaired by the party's general secretary, Paulo Pombolo.
The BP Secretariat members welcomed the start, this Thursday, of the Ex-Officio electoral registration process, which foresees to cover all voting age population.
The meeting which analysed internal issues assessed the organic process of the VIII ordinary congress of the MPLA in Luanda.
The participants focused on the holding of municipal conferences, scheduled for the 24th and 25th September this year.
The meeting also appreciated the memorandum on the evaluation of the MPLA's electoral performance in the provinces of Luanda and Lunda Sul, the proposal of solutions for the upcoming political and electoral challenges.
It also analysed the document on the status of the management process and monitoring the replacements and renewal of electoral commissioners appointed by the party.
The members of the MPLA's executive body analysed other matters relating to the party's VIII ordinary congress, namely the agenda and the general work programme, the internal regulations and the chairmanship of the commissions, as well as the summary minutes of the meeting on evaluation sanitary and biosafety conditions for the conclave.
The meeting also discussed matters on the holding of ordinary provincial conferences, as well as other internal issues, in addition to the political, economic and social situation in the country.
